Dalai Lama's elder brother, who led several rounds of talks with China, dies at 97
Dalai Lama and former chairman of the exiled Tibetan government in India, Gyalo Thondup, who led several rounds of talks with China and worked with foreign governments for the Tibetan cause, has died. He was 97.

Billionaire Elon Musk says not interested in acquiring TikTok
Elon Musk said that he was not interested in purchasing TikTok, the popular short-video app that the United States has been trying to ban over national security concerns with its Chinese owner ByteDance.

Taiwan reports detection of 14 Chinese aircraft and 6 PLAN vessels operating near its shores
Taiwan's Ministry of National Defense (MND) reported that 14 Chinese People's Liberation Army (PLA) aircraft and 6 People's Liberation Army Navy (PLAN) vessels were detected around Taiwan as of 6 am local time (UTC+8) today.

Is the US stock market's global dominance falling by the day? Here's what a Bank of America strategist is claiming
US stock market has been seeing a dream run for the better part of two years, but its relentless run has now slowed down steadily, and the slump of tech stocks, along with a dip in the stock indexes has become a major point of concern for US investors now. Meanwhile, Bank of America strategist Hartnett is claiming that the outperformance of the US stock market may begin fading soon, according to a Bloomberg report.

Hong Kong's post office continues to suspend packages for US
Hong Kong’s post office has announced it would continue to suspend shipping items containing goods to the United States until further notice, despite its American counterpart having reversed its ban on packages from the city and other parts of China

China lashes out at US 'coercion' as Panama declines to renew agreement
China on lashed out at what it called U.S. “coercion” after Panama declined to renew a key infrastructure agreement with Beijing following Washington’s threat to take back the Panama Canal
